Ingredients

  • 1 cup fresh parsley, finely chopped
  • 1/2 cup fresh cilantro, finely chopped
  • 4 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1/2 cup olive oil
  • 1/4 cup red wine vinegar
  • 1 teaspoon red pepper flakes
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Directions

  1. In a bowl, combine the parsley, cilantro, garlic, olive oil, red wine vinegar, and red pepper flakes.
  2. Mix well and season with salt and pepper to taste.
  3. Let the chimichurri sit for at least 30 minutes to allow the flavors to meld before serving with grilled steak, chicken, fish, or vegetables.

How to serve Herbacious Chimichurri Sauce

This chimichurri sauce is incredibly versatile. It pairs beautifully with grilled meats like steak and chicken but can also elevate the flavor of fish and roasted vegetables. Drizzle it over your dish just before serving or use it as a dipping sauce for extra flavor.

How to store Herbacious Chimichurri Sauce

To store your chimichurri sauce, transfer it to an airtight container and place it in the refrigerator. It will keep well for up to a week, letting you enjoy its fresh flavors for several meals. If you want to store it for longer, consider freezing it in smaller portions.

Tips to make Herbacious Chimichurri Sauce

  1. Allow the sauce to sit for at least 30 minutes before serving to deepen the flavors.
  2. Feel free to adjust the garlic or red pepper flakes according to your taste preferences.
  3. For a smoother texture, blend the ingredients in a food processor instead of chopping by hand.

Variation

You can customize your chimichurri by adding different herbs like oregano or mint. For a citrusy twist, zest and juice a lime or orange and mix it in for a refreshing flavor.

FAQs

Can I use dried herbs instead of fresh?

While you can use dried herbs, fresh herbs provide a much brighter flavor. If you must use dried herbs, use about one-third of the amount.

How long can I keep chimichurri sauce?

Chimichurri can last in the fridge for up to a week. Make sure it’s stored in an airtight container.

What can I eat with chimichurri sauce?

Chimichurri goes well with grilled meats, seafood, and roasted vegetables. You can also use it as a marinade or salad dressing!
